Summary

CVE-2023-41718 is a cyber vulnerability that affects multiple products, including tN3eTy, tN3eTz, tN3eTw, and tN3eTx. It allows an attacker to gain unauthorized elevated privileges on the affected system by exploiting a specific file when a particular process flow is initiated. The vulnerability has a high severity rating with a base score of 7.8 and poses potential dangers to organizations due to its impact on integrity and confidentiality. Remediation measures should be taken to address this vulnerability and prevent unauthorized access to sensitive information.
